Pushing Products with Variable Force

Variable Force Springs, also known as V-Springs, are commonly used to push products on shelves in retail shopping environments.  Research shows it is more likely a consumer will make an impulse purchase if the product is forward on the shelf than if placed back in the shadows of a display.
